5. Discussion:
a. Directors Update
i. Budget FY23-34
1. Katy mentioned that there was a lot of support at the first budget
retreat meeting for next fiscal year. The Parks and Recreation truck is in
for the Parks Superintendent and the department has registered the
vehicle. The department is waiting on the tags to get in from the DMV.
Upcoming projects include the ordering of a storage shed located
behind the Community House. This would allow extra storage for tools
and equipment for the Parks Superintendent.
ii. Future Capital Projects
1. Items that are on the Capital Project list for FY23-24 include additional
funds for the tennis courts, basketball court reconstruction, and Rock
Ridge Park playground funds. These are all funds that have been
discussed at length with Finance and was well received by the Board at
this time. Final approval of next year’s budget will be towards the end of
May or beginning of June 2023.
6. Arbor Day/Earth Day Planning Decision
a. Partnering with the Girl Scouts Troop 1024
i. Katy welcomed Troop 1024 to the meeting. Katy explained that Troop 1024
typically partnered with the Arbor Day Event. In lieu of an Arbor Day event, this
year the event was Earthfest put on by the Parks and Recreation Advisory
Board. Troop 1024 was interested in partnering with this event. Introductions
were made via the PARAB members as well as Troop 1024 members.
b. Planning & Marketing
i. Katy explained that she and Maura have been working with the Girl Scouts
group on planning which stations the Girl Scouts Troop would like to help lead.
Jeanine then stated that after their latest Troop meeting, that the girls would be
interested in the following stations: seed bombs, birdseed pinecones, and
scavenger hunt/nature origami. The Troop would be providing the scavenger
hunt materials while the Town would provide the remaining nature station
materials.
ii. In further day-of planning, the Girl Scouts Troop will bring hand washing
stations. Katy said that the Town would be providing tables and chairs for the
events. Josh asked a question regarding what would happen if it rained the day
of. Katy further committed that the event would be rain or shine and asked if it
rained, for any of the planning committee members would bring an extra tent if
they had one.
